The Staff Clinical Informaticist supports clinical operations and organizational readiness by bridging clinical practice, technology, and product strategy. This role ensures new product processes are clinically sound, operationally feasible, and readiness focused. Partnering closely with clinical subject matter experts, R&D, product teams, and operational leaders, the Staff Clinical Informaticist drives successful clinical adoption scalable process design.
